Yashwantrao Chavan Maharashtra Open University offers an MBA at the postgraduate level. The minimum duration to complete this course is two years and the maximum is five years. The programme consists of 20 modules and its project work is spread over 4 semesters in two academic years. Candidates seeking admission to this course are required to meet the minimum eligibility criteria set by the university apart from a valid score in the entrance test, conducted by YCMOU Digital University.

MBA is a flagship programme of AIMS Institutes. It is offered in six specialisations. The course duration of this programme is two years, each year consisting of two semesters. Selection to this programme is based on the valid score in PGCET/ CAT/ MAT/ ATMA or any state-approved admission test. This programme has a total seat intake of 240 students. Candidates with work experience will be given preference in the selection process. The lastest cutoff for MBA sectional is tabulated below:
| Master of Business Administration (MBA) - AIMS Bangalore : CAT percentile Cutoff (General-All India) |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Section |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 |
| Overall | 60 | 60 | 60 |
| Quants | 40 | 40 | 40 |
| VA-RC | 40 | 40 | 40 |
| DI-LR | 40 | 40 | 40 |

For admission to MBA program, a candidate need to complete Graduation with at least 50% marks in any stream (Arts / Science /Commerce).Candidates are selected based on the rank/score/percentile in national-level entrance exams such as CAT, MAT, XAT, GMAT, CMAT, SNAP, ATMA, NMAT, EMAT among others, and performance in group discussion/personal interviews. Direct admissions are made available in some Private Management Institutes on the basis of rank marks, percentile obtained at nationally held entrance tests. Nevertheless, an interview may be organised by these colleges and universities or institutes for the selection of candidates.

LIT Lucknow admission to MBA course is based on merit in the last qualifying exam. Candidates who have completed graduation with at least 50% aggregate can apply for the MBA course. After completion of the selection rounds, candidates need to pay a fee to confirm their seat. The total course fee for MBA is INR 1 lakh.
